Recognition
Awards received include Order of the Badge of Honour[14], a socialist order of merit[27], in Soviet Union[28], founded in 1935[29]; People's Artist of the USSR[15], an award[30], in Soviet Union[31], founded in 1936[32]; Order of the Red Banner of Labour[16], a socialist order of merit[33], in Soviet Union[34], founded in 1928[35]; Order of Kurmet[17], an order[36], in Kazakhstan[37], founded in 1993[38]; People's Artist of Kazakh SSR[18], a title of honor[39], in Soviet Union[40], founded in 1940[41]; and Honoured Artist of Kazakh SSR[19], a title of honor[42], in Soviet Union[43], founded in 1931[44].
